The West End Bridge is a steel bowstring arch bridge over the Ohio River near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, approximately one mile below the confluence of the Allegheny and Monongahela Rivers. The bridge was built from 1930 to 1932 primarily by the American Bridge Company (superstructure) and the Foundation Company (substructure). The bridge was placed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1979.
